Skip to main content
Erschienen in: Software and Systems Modeling 3/2018

02.07.2016 | Special Section Paper

Modeling context-aware and intention-aware in-car infotainment systems

Concepts and modeling processes

verfasst von: Daniel Lüddecke, Christoph Seidl, Jens Schneider, Ina Schaefer

Erschienen in: Software and Systems Modeling | Ausgabe 3/2018

Einloggen

Aktivieren Sie unsere intelligente Suche, um passende Fachinhalte oder Patente zu finden.

search-config
loading …

Abstract

It is fundamental to understand users’ intentions to support them when operating a computer system with a dynamically varying set of functions, e.g., within an in-car infotainment system. The system needs to have sufficient information about its own and the user’s context to predict those intentions. Although the development of current in-car infotainment systems is already model-based, explicitly gathering and modeling contextual information and user intentions is currently not supported. However, manually creating software that understands the current context and predicts user intentions is complex, error-prone and expensive. Model-based development can help in overcoming these issues. In this paper, we present an approach for modeling a user’s intention based on Bayesian networks. We support developers of in-car infotainment systems by providing means to model possible user intentions according to the current context. We further allow modeling of user preferences and show how the modeled intentions may change during run-time as a result of the user’s behavior. We demonstrate feasibility of our approach using an industrial case study of an intention-aware in-car infotainment system. Finally, we show how modeling of contextual information and modeling user intentions can be combined by using model transformation.

Sie haben noch keine Lizenz? Dann Informieren Sie sich jetzt über unsere Produkte:

Springer Professional "Wirtschaft+Technik"

Online-Abonnement

Mit Springer Professional "Wirtschaft+Technik" erhalten Sie Zugriff auf:

  • über 102.000 Bücher
  • über 537 Zeitschriften

aus folgenden Fachgebieten:

  • Automobil + Motoren
  • Bauwesen + Immobilien
  • Business IT + Informatik
  • Elektrotechnik + Elektronik
  • Energie + Nachhaltigkeit
  • Finance + Banking
  • Management + Führung
  • Marketing + Vertrieb
  • Maschinenbau + Werkstoffe
  • Versicherung + Risiko

Jetzt Wissensvorsprung sichern!

Springer Professional "Wirtschaft"

Online-Abonnement

Mit Springer Professional "Wirtschaft" erhalten Sie Zugriff auf:

  • über 67.000 Bücher
  • über 340 Zeitschriften

aus folgenden Fachgebieten:

  • Bauwesen + Immobilien
  • Business IT + Informatik
  • Finance + Banking
  • Management + Führung
  • Marketing + Vertrieb
  • Versicherung + Risiko




Jetzt Wissensvorsprung sichern!

Springer Professional "Technik"

Online-Abonnement

Mit Springer Professional "Technik" erhalten Sie Zugriff auf:

  • über 67.000 Bücher
  • über 390 Zeitschriften

aus folgenden Fachgebieten:

  • Automobil + Motoren
  • Bauwesen + Immobilien
  • Business IT + Informatik
  • Elektrotechnik + Elektronik
  • Energie + Nachhaltigkeit
  • Maschinenbau + Werkstoffe




 

Jetzt Wissensvorsprung sichern!

Fußnoten
1
A detailed discussion of the term context can be found in [7].
 
2
BMA (Bayes Mean Averaged) estimator as implemented in Weka.
 
5
As our approach currently requires the modeler to know possible user intentions during modeling time, the system is not able to predict a probability for a certain telephone number but for a certain contact from favorites.
 
6
The dataset was stored using the Attribute-Relation File Format (ARFF) (http://​www.​cs.​waikato.​ac.​nz/​ml/​weka/​arff.​html).
 
7
A rectangular box represents a task. A rectangular box with a bent upper right corner represents a document. A rectangular box with a bent upper right corner surrounded by a dotted line represents multiple documents. Arrows represent the work flow.
 
Literatur
1.
Zurück zum Zitat Ablaßmeier, M., Poitschke, T., Reifinger, S., Rigoll, G.: Context-aware information agents for the automotive domain using bayesian networks. In: Smith, M.J., Salvendy, G. (eds.) Human Interface and the Management of Information. Methods, Techniques and Tools in Information Design. Lecture Notes in Computer Science, vol. 4557, pp. 561–570. Springer, Berlin (2007) Ablaßmeier, M., Poitschke, T., Reifinger, S., Rigoll, G.: Context-aware information agents for the automotive domain using bayesian networks. In: Smith, M.J., Salvendy, G. (eds.) Human Interface and the Management of Information. Methods, Techniques and Tools in Information Design. Lecture Notes in Computer Science, vol. 4557, pp. 561–570. Springer, Berlin (2007)
2.
Zurück zum Zitat Bandyopadhyay, T., Won, K.S., Frazzoli, E., Hsu, D., Lee, W.S., Rus, D.: Intention-aware motion planning. In: Frazzoli, E., Lozano-Perez, T., Roy, N., Rus, D. (eds.) Algorithmic Foundations of Robotics X, Springer Tracts in Advanced Robotics, vol. 86, pp. 475–491. Springer, Berlin (2013)CrossRef Bandyopadhyay, T., Won, K.S., Frazzoli, E., Hsu, D., Lee, W.S., Rus, D.: Intention-aware motion planning. In: Frazzoli, E., Lozano-Perez, T., Roy, N., Rus, D. (eds.) Algorithmic Foundations of Robotics X, Springer Tracts in Advanced Robotics, vol. 86, pp. 475–491. Springer, Berlin (2013)CrossRef
3.
Zurück zum Zitat Bayes, Price: An essay towards solving a problem in the doctrine of chances. by the late rev. mr. bayes, f. r. s. communicated by mr. price, in a letter to john canton, a. m. f. r. s. Philos. Trans. Royal Soc. Lond. 53, 370–418 (1763)CrossRefMATH Bayes, Price: An essay towards solving a problem in the doctrine of chances. by the late rev. mr. bayes, f. r. s. communicated by mr. price, in a letter to john canton, a. m. f. r. s. Philos. Trans. Royal Soc. Lond. 53, 370–418 (1763)CrossRefMATH
4.
Zurück zum Zitat Ben-Gal, I.: Bayesian networks. In: Ruggeri, F., Kenett, R.S., Faltin, F.W. (eds.) Encyclopedia of Statistics in Quality and Reliability. Wiley, Chichester (2008) Ben-Gal, I.: Bayesian networks. In: Ruggeri, F., Kenett, R.S., Faltin, F.W. (eds.) Encyclopedia of Statistics in Quality and Reliability. Wiley, Chichester (2008)
5.
Zurück zum Zitat Berndt, H., Emmert, J., Dietmayer, K.: Continuous driver intention recognition with hidden markov models. In: 11th International IEEE Conference on Intelligent Transportation Systems (ITSC), pp. 1189–1194. (2008) Berndt, H., Emmert, J., Dietmayer, K.: Continuous driver intention recognition with hidden markov models. In: 11th International IEEE Conference on Intelligent Transportation Systems (ITSC), pp. 1189–1194. (2008)
6.
Zurück zum Zitat Bettini, C., Brdiczka, O., Henricksen, K., Indulska, J., Nicklas, D., Ranganathan, A., Riboni, D.: A survey of context modelling and reasoning techniques. Pervasive Mob. Comput. 6(2), 161–180 (2010)CrossRef Bettini, C., Brdiczka, O., Henricksen, K., Indulska, J., Nicklas, D., Ranganathan, A., Riboni, D.: A survey of context modelling and reasoning techniques. Pervasive Mob. Comput. 6(2), 161–180 (2010)CrossRef
7.
Zurück zum Zitat Chen, G., Kotz, D.: A survey of context-aware mobile computing research. Technical Report TR2000-381, Dartmouth College, Computer Science, Hanover (2000) Chen, G., Kotz, D.: A survey of context-aware mobile computing research. Technical Report TR2000-381, Dartmouth College, Computer Science, Hanover (2000)
8.
Zurück zum Zitat Cooper, G., Herskovits, E.: A bayesian method for the induction of probabilistic networks from data. Mach. Learn. 9(4), 309–347 (1992)MATH Cooper, G., Herskovits, E.: A bayesian method for the induction of probabilistic networks from data. Mach. Learn. 9(4), 309–347 (1992)MATH
9.
Zurück zum Zitat Dirk Vanhooydonck, Eric Demeester, Marnix Nuttin, Hendrik Van Brussel: Shared control for intelligent wheelchairs: an implicit estimation of the user intention. In: Proceedings of the ASER ’03 1st International Workshop on Advances in Service Robotics, pp. 13–15. (2003) Dirk Vanhooydonck, Eric Demeester, Marnix Nuttin, Hendrik Van Brussel: Shared control for intelligent wheelchairs: an implicit estimation of the user intention. In: Proceedings of the ASER ’03 1st International Workshop on Advances in Service Robotics, pp. 13–15. (2003)
10.
Zurück zum Zitat Doshi, A., Trivedi, M.M.: Tactical driver behavior prediction and intent inference: a review. In: 14th International IEEE Conference on Intelligent Transportation Systems—(ITSC 2011), pp. 1892–1897. (2011) Doshi, A., Trivedi, M.M.: Tactical driver behavior prediction and intent inference: a review. In: 14th International IEEE Conference on Intelligent Transportation Systems—(ITSC 2011), pp. 1892–1897. (2011)
11.
Zurück zum Zitat Guha, R., Gupta, V., Raghunathan, V., Srikant, R.: User modeling for a personal assistant. In: Proceedings of the Eighth ACM International Conference on Web Search and Data Mining. WSDM ’15, pp. 275–284. ACM, New York (2015) Guha, R., Gupta, V., Raghunathan, V., Srikant, R.: User modeling for a personal assistant. In: Proceedings of the Eighth ACM International Conference on Web Search and Data Mining. WSDM ’15, pp. 275–284. ACM, New York (2015)
13.
Zurück zum Zitat Iba, S., Paredis, C., Khosla, P.K.: Intention aware interactive multi-modal robot programming. In: IEEE/RSJ International Conference on Intelligent Robots and Systems, pp. 3479–3484. (2003) Iba, S., Paredis, C., Khosla, P.K.: Intention aware interactive multi-modal robot programming. In: IEEE/RSJ International Conference on Intelligent Robots and Systems, pp. 3479–3484. (2003)
14.
Zurück zum Zitat Kuge, N., Yamamura, T., Shimoyama, O., Liu, A.: A Driver Behavior Recognition Method Based on a Driver Model Framework. SAE International, Warrendale (2000)CrossRef Kuge, N., Yamamura, T., Shimoyama, O., Liu, A.: A Driver Behavior Recognition Method Based on a Driver Model Framework. SAE International, Warrendale (2000)CrossRef
15.
Zurück zum Zitat Lüddecke, D., Bergmann, N., Schaefer, I.: Ontology-based modeling of context-aware systems. In: Proceedings of the 17th International Conference on Model Driven Engineering Languages and Systems. Lecture Notes in Computer Science, vol. 8767, pp. 484–500. Springer International Publishing, Cham (2014) Lüddecke, D., Bergmann, N., Schaefer, I.: Ontology-based modeling of context-aware systems. In: Proceedings of the 17th International Conference on Model Driven Engineering Languages and Systems. Lecture Notes in Computer Science, vol. 8767, pp. 484–500. Springer International Publishing, Cham (2014)
16.
Zurück zum Zitat Lüddecke, D., Seidl, C., Schaefer, I.: Efficient ontology-based modeling of context-aware in-car infotainment systems: Benchmark infrastructure and design guidelines. In: Proceedings of the International Workshop on Modelling in Automotive Software Engineering, CEUR Workshop Proceedings vol. 1487, pp. 23–32. (2015) Lüddecke, D., Seidl, C., Schaefer, I.: Efficient ontology-based modeling of context-aware in-car infotainment systems: Benchmark infrastructure and design guidelines. In: Proceedings of the International Workshop on Modelling in Automotive Software Engineering, CEUR Workshop Proceedings vol. 1487, pp. 23–32. (2015)
17.
Zurück zum Zitat Lüddecke, D., Seidl, C., Schneider, J., Schaefer, I.: Modeling user intentions for in-car infotainment systems using bayesian networks. In: ACM/IEEE 18th International Conference on Model Driven Engineering Languages and Systems (MODELS), pp. 378–385. (2015) Lüddecke, D., Seidl, C., Schneider, J., Schaefer, I.: Modeling user intentions for in-car infotainment systems using bayesian networks. In: ACM/IEEE 18th International Conference on Model Driven Engineering Languages and Systems (MODELS), pp. 378–385. (2015)
18.
Zurück zum Zitat Markov, A.A.: An example of statistical investigation of the text eugene onegin concerning the connection of samples in chains. In: Proceedings of the Academy of Science, p. 153. St. Petersburg (1913) Markov, A.A.: An example of statistical investigation of the text eugene onegin concerning the connection of samples in chains. In: Proceedings of the Academy of Science, p. 153. St. Petersburg (1913)
20.
Zurück zum Zitat Nguyen, L.T., Jauregui, B., Dinges, D.F.: Changing Behaviors to Prevent Drowsy Driving and Promote Traffic Safety: Review of Proven, Promising, and Unproven Techniques. AAA Foundation for Traffic Safety, Pennsylvania (1998) Nguyen, L.T., Jauregui, B., Dinges, D.F.: Changing Behaviors to Prevent Drowsy Driving and Promote Traffic Safety: Review of Proven, Promising, and Unproven Techniques. AAA Foundation for Traffic Safety, Pennsylvania (1998)
21.
Zurück zum Zitat Pearl, J.: Bayesian networks: A model of self-activated memory for evidential reasoning, 1985. In: Proceedings of the 7th Conference of the Cognitive Science Society, pp. 329–334. University of California, Irvine (1985) Pearl, J.: Bayesian networks: A model of self-activated memory for evidential reasoning, 1985. In: Proceedings of the 7th Conference of the Cognitive Science Society, pp. 329–334. University of California, Irvine (1985)
22.
Zurück zum Zitat Rodriguez Garzon, S.: Intelligent in-car-infotainment system: a prototypical implementation. In: 8th International Conference on Intelligent Environments (IE), pp. 371–374. (2012) Rodriguez Garzon, S.: Intelligent in-car-infotainment system: a prototypical implementation. In: 8th International Conference on Intelligent Environments (IE), pp. 371–374. (2012)
23.
Zurück zum Zitat Salvucci, D.D.: Inferring driver intent: a case study in lane-change detection. Proc. Hum. Factors Ergon. Soc. Annu. Meet. 48(19), 2228–2231 (2004)CrossRef Salvucci, D.D.: Inferring driver intent: a case study in lane-change detection. Proc. Hum. Factors Ergon. Soc. Annu. Meet. 48(19), 2228–2231 (2004)CrossRef
24.
Zurück zum Zitat Schäuffele, J., Zurawka, T.: Automotive Software Engineering, 5th edn. Springer, Berlin (2013)CrossRef Schäuffele, J., Zurawka, T.: Automotive Software Engineering, 5th edn. Springer, Berlin (2013)CrossRef
25.
Zurück zum Zitat Singh, M., Valtorta, M.: Construction of bayesian network structures from data: a brief survey and an efficient algorithm. Int. J. Approx. Reason. 12(2), 111–131 (1995)CrossRefMATH Singh, M., Valtorta, M.: Construction of bayesian network structures from data: a brief survey and an efficient algorithm. Int. J. Approx. Reason. 12(2), 111–131 (1995)CrossRefMATH
26.
Zurück zum Zitat Strang, T., Linnhoff-Popien, C.: a context modeling survey. In: Proceedings of the 6th International Conference on Ubiquitous Computing. Workshop on Advanced Context Modelling, Reasoning and Management. Lecture Notes in Computer Science (LNCS), vol. 3205. Springer, (2004) Strang, T., Linnhoff-Popien, C.: a context modeling survey. In: Proceedings of the 6th International Conference on Ubiquitous Computing. Workshop on Advanced Context Modelling, Reasoning and Management. Lecture Notes in Computer Science (LNCS), vol. 3205. Springer, (2004)
27.
Zurück zum Zitat Winner, H., Hakuli, S., Wolf, G.: Handbuch Fahrerassistenzsysteme: Grundlagen, Komponenten und Systeme für aktive Sicherheit und Komfort, 1st edn. Vieweg+Teubner, Wiesbaden (2009)CrossRef Winner, H., Hakuli, S., Wolf, G.: Handbuch Fahrerassistenzsysteme: Grundlagen, Komponenten und Systeme für aktive Sicherheit und Komfort, 1st edn. Vieweg+Teubner, Wiesbaden (2009)CrossRef
28.
Zurück zum Zitat Yin, H., Cui, B., Chen, L., Hu, Z., Zhou, X.: Dynamic user modeling in social media systems. ACM Trans. Inf. Syst. 33(3), 10:1–10:44 (2015)CrossRef Yin, H., Cui, B., Chen, L., Hu, Z., Zhou, X.: Dynamic user modeling in social media systems. ACM Trans. Inf. Syst. 33(3), 10:1–10:44 (2015)CrossRef
Metadaten
Titel
Modeling context-aware and intention-aware in-car infotainment systems
Concepts and modeling processes
verfasst von
Daniel Lüddecke
Christoph Seidl
Jens Schneider
Ina Schaefer
Publikationsdatum
02.07.2016
Verlag
Springer Berlin Heidelberg
Erschienen in
Software and Systems Modeling / Ausgabe 3/2018
Print ISSN: 1619-1366
Elektronische ISSN: 1619-1374
DOI
https://doi.org/10.1007/s10270-016-0543-z

Weitere Artikel der Ausgabe 3/2018

Software and Systems Modeling 3/2018 Zur Ausgabe